| Frame | Vibration-dampening carbon-fiber drive arms with folding-steering column |
| Gear Range | 11 gears for steep hills and flats |
| Stride Length | Adjustable from 16 to 25 inches |
| Weight Limit | 250 lbs (113 kg) |
| Adjustability | Adjustable steering column for a custom fit |
| Indoor Compatibility | Compatible with Fluid 365 Stationary Trainer (sold separately) |
Unlike most stand-up bikes that feel like a typical bike on steroids, the ElliptiGO 11R immediately impresses with its smooth, running-like pedaling motion. You’ll notice how effortlessly it transitions from flat to steep hills thanks to the 11 gears and its unique stride adjustment.
The carbon-fiber drive arms dampen vibrations, making each pedal stroke feel surprisingly comfortable even after long rides.
The adjustable stride length, from 16 to 25 inches, is a game-changer. You can fine-tune it to match your height or the terrain, which means fewer aches and a more natural feel.
The large foot platforms are spacious enough to accommodate different foot positions, so you won’t feel cramped or awkward during intense sessions. The broad handlebars and adjustable steering column let you find your perfect grip, helping eliminate neck and back strain.

How Does Riding a Stand Up Bicycle Benefit Your Health?
- Improved Cardiovascular Health: Engaging in regular cycling helps to strengthen the heart, improve circulation, and lower blood pressure. The aerobic nature of riding a stand up bicycle increases heart rate and promotes better oxygen flow throughout the body.
- Enhanced Core Strength: Stand up bicycles require riders to maintain balance, which activates core muscles including the abdominals and back. This engagement helps to build stability and strength in the core, leading to better posture and reduced risk of injury.
- Increased Caloric Burn: Riding a stand up bicycle can burn more calories compared to traditional cycling due to the additional effort required to maintain an upright position. This makes it an effective option for those looking to lose weight or maintain a healthy weight.
- Lower Impact on Joints: The design of stand up bicycles allows for a more natural riding position that can reduce strain on the knees and hips. This makes it a suitable exercise option for individuals with joint issues or those recovering from injuries.
- Improved Balance and Coordination: Riding in a standing position helps to enhance overall balance and coordination skills. This is especially beneficial for older adults, as improved balance can contribute to a reduced risk of falls and injuries.
What Essential Factors Should You Consider When Selecting a Stand Up Bicycle?
When selecting the best stand up bicycle, there are several essential factors to consider that will enhance your riding experience.
- Frame Material: The frame material significantly affects the bike’s weight, durability, and ride quality. Common materials include aluminum, which is lightweight and resistant to rust, and steel, known for its strength and comfort but is heavier.
- Geometry: The geometry of a bicycle determines its handling characteristics and comfort level. A stand up bike should have an upright riding position that allows for better visibility and comfort, especially during longer rides.
- Wheel Size: Wheel size impacts the bike’s stability and speed. Larger wheels (typically 26 inches or more) offer better rolling efficiency over rough terrain, while smaller wheels can provide quicker acceleration and maneuverability.
- Saddle Comfort: A comfortable saddle is crucial for enjoyable rides, especially on a stand up bike where you may spend extended periods in the saddle. Look for saddles with adequate padding and support that cater to your riding style and body type.
- Braking System: The braking system is vital for safety and control while riding. Options include rim brakes, which are lightweight and easy to maintain, and disc brakes, which provide superior stopping power in various weather conditions.
- Gear System: The gear system influences how easy it is to ride uphill or at higher speeds. A bike with multiple gears can make it easier to tackle different terrains, while single-speed bikes offer simplicity and lower maintenance.
- Weight Capacity: Knowing the bike’s weight capacity is important, particularly if you plan to carry additional gear or use it for commuting. Ensure that the bike can comfortably accommodate your weight along with any cargo you might carry.
- Price: Finally, consider your budget, as prices can vary widely based on brand, features, and build quality. It’s essential to find a balance between affordability and the necessary features that meet your needs.
